Deakin recycling and renewable energy hub is soon to get huge government funding.
Deakin's recycling and renewable energy initiative is shortlisted in the Australian Government's new Trailblazer Universities Program..
The recycling and sustainable energy programme at Deakin University have been named a finalist in the Australian Government's new Trailblazer Universities Program, placing it just one step away from receiving $242.7 million in funding..
The Recycling and Renewable Energy Commercialisation Hub (REACH) is one of eight federal Trailblazer proposals shortlisted, and it has the potential to spur major innovation and job development in Geelong, Western Victoria, and beyond. The shortlist's four winning concepts will be unveiled early next month..
